Output 86e8ca9329fd60e2cd1e20e4ebb65b520b24f42a4f7d0b78af70cda9ea50cb7b:0

value
535783
script pubkey
OP_0 OP_PUSHBYTES_20 e0ce877f67eaf6ff351a4bcbe6cc155cda7e596f
address
bc1qur8gwlm8atm07dg6f097dnq4tnd8ukt0ymn6mn
transaction
86e8ca9329fd60e2cd1e20e4ebb65b520b24f42a4f7d0b78af70cda9ea50cb7b
confirmations
149841
spent
true